Florida Wildlife Control: Keeping Gators in Check

With sunny Florida weather and abundant ponds, alligators populate the state. While these magnificent creatures are a vital part of the ecosystem, their proximity near human settlements can pose a threat. That's where Florida Wildlife Control steps in, guaranteeing public safety and coexisting with nature.

Our skilled and experienced professionals are certified to respectfully relocate alligators from populated areas, returning them to more suitable habitats. We utilize the latest strategies to minimize any interference to these animals and their habitat.

Periodically monitoring alligator populations, carrying out public education programs, and enforcing state regulations are all crucial components of our mission. By working together, we can maintain a safe and healthy environment for both Floridians and these magnificent creatures.

It's important to remember that alligators are wild animals and should be treated with care. Refrain from feeding or approaching them, and always keep a safe distance. If you encounter an alligator in your neighborhood, contact your local Florida Wildlife Control office immediately.
